N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

THE AIRCRAFT STRUCK A GUARD RAIL DURING AN EMERGENCY LANDING ON INTERSTATE 80 AFTER EXPERIENCING FUEL EXHAUSTION. THE PILOT HAD VISUALLY INSPECTED HIS FUEL SUPPLY PRIOR TO THE FIRST LEG OF THE FLIGHT AND THOUGHT THERE WAS ENOUGH FUEL FOR THE TRIP. INSPECTION OF THE AIRCRAFT AFTER THE ACCIDENT BY BOTH FAA AND INDIANA STATE POLICE PERSONNEL REVEALED THE FUEL TANKS EMPTY AND NO SIGNS OF FUEL LEAKAGE.
